Top Banana Home Delivered Groceries, Inc. was a top-five finalist for the Prince George's County Board of Trade Small Business of the Year Award 2001 and was the only nonprofit.

Dear Ms. Guiffre:

I am writing for two purposes. The first is to convey my appreciation for the help that you and Mr. Larry Burton have been to the medical care Policy Administration. You alerted us to the existence of Top Banana and to the importance of the service and then provided us with information that was very helpful as we developed service descriptions and provider requirements for a potential Medicaid home and community-based services waiver. We were very impressed by your professionalism and enthusiasm for this service.

--Michael S. Franch, Ph.D.
Medical Care Program Specialist.
